Ocado has secured a new deal to build a large automated warehouse for an unnamed, fast-growing European retailer, giving its robotics business an important new customer after a challenging period for the company.
The new Customer Fulfilment Centre (CFC) is expected to become operational in 2028. It will use Ocado’s latest Re technology, including its 600 Series robots, On-Grid Robotic Pick system, and fully automated freezer. The retailer plans to quickly transfer existing online orders to the facility, with the warehouse expected to open at just over half of its total design capacity.
The identity of the retailer and the financial terms of the agreement have not been disclosed.
The agreement is particularly interesting because Ocado has recently faced questions about demand for its large automated fulfilment centres.
Several facilities operated by North American partners have closed or faced changes as online grocery demand developed differently than expected. Kroger closed three automated warehouses in the US, while Canadian retailer Sobeys also reduced its commitment to Ocado’s CFC model.
Meanwhile, Ocado has expanded its strategy. Rather than relying exclusively on large centralized warehouses, the company is increasingly offering technology that can automate fulfilment from retailers’ existing store networks.
Earlier this year, for example, Ocado signed an agreement with Asda to provide software and automation technology for its e-commerce operations.
The new European deal therefore shows that Ocado has not abandoned the large CFC model. Instead, it is developing several fulfilment options for retailers with different operational requirements.
The upcoming facility will showcase several technologies designed to reduce manual work inside fulfilment centres.
Ocado’s lightweight 600 Series robots move across its warehouse grid to retrieve products, while On-Grid Robotic Pick allows robotic arms to pick items directly from storage. The automated freezer extends this approach to frozen goods, which have traditionally been one of the more challenging areas to automate.
Together, these systems are designed to automate a larger proportion of the online grocery ordering process, from storage through picking and preparation.
For a retailer that already has significant e-commerce volumes, this can make fulfilment faster and reduce the amount of manual handling required for each order.
Robots may physically move the products, but successful automated fulfilment also depends heavily on information.
A grocery warehouse can contain thousands of products with different dimensions, weights, packaging types, storage requirements, and expiration characteristics. Automated systems need to identify these items correctly and understand how they should be stored and handled.
That makes accurate product information part of the operational infrastructure.
Structured attributes such as dimensions, weight, identifiers, packaging details, and product categories can support warehouse planning and automated processes while maintaining consistency between the physical product and its digital record.
For e-commerce retailers, the same information can then support the customer-facing side of the journey, including product pages, search, filtering, recommendations, and AI-powered discovery.
